Java常量和变量
在Java编程语言中,常量和变量是最基本的数据存储单元。本文将介绍Java中常量和变量的概念、声明和使用,以及它们在编程中的重要性。
常量
常量是在程序执行期间其值不会发生改变的数据。在Java中,可以使用final
关键字来声明一个常量。一旦常量被赋值后,就无法再修改其值。常量通常用大写字母表示,以便在代码中更容易识别。
常量可以是基本数据类型(如整数、浮点数、字符、布尔值)或引用类型(如字符串、对象等)。
以下是一个使用final
关键字声明常量的示例:
final double PI = 3.14159;
final int MAX_SIZE = 100;
final String MESSAGE = "Hello, World!";
变量
变量是在程序执行期间其值可以发生改变的数据。在Java中,变量必须先声明后使用。声明一个变量需要指定变量的类型和名称。变量的名称通常使用小写字母,可以使用下划线(_)分隔单词。
以下是一个声明和使用变量的示例:
int age;
double salary;
String name;
age = 25;
salary = 5000.0;
name = "John Doe";
System.out.println("Name: " + name);
System.out.println("Age: " + age);
System.out.println("Salary: " + salary);
输出结果:
Name: John Doe
Age: 25
Salary: 5000.0
可以在声明变量的同时进行初始化:
int age = 25;
double salary = 5000.0;
String name = "John Doe";
常量和变量的重要性
常量和变量在编程中起着重要的作用。使用常量可以提高代码的可读性和可维护性。通过使用常量,可以将具有特定含义的值命名,并在整个程序中重复使用。这样,如果需要修改该值,只需修改常量的定义即可,而不需要在整个代码中进行修改。
变量允许我们在程序执行过程中存储和操作数据。通过使用变量,我们可以在程序中保存和更新数据的状态。这样,我们可以根据需要对数据进行计算、处理和输出。
以下是一个使用常量和变量的示例,计算圆的面积:
final double PI = 3.14159;
double radius = 5.0;
double area = PI * radius * radius;
System.out.println("Area: " + area);
输出结果:
Area: 78.53975
总结
本文介绍了Java中常量和变量的概念、声明和使用。常量是值不可变的数据,使用final
关键字来声明。变量是可以改变值的数据,必须先声明后使用。常量和变量在编程中起着重要的作用,可以提高代码的可读性和可维护性,并允许我们在程序执行过程中存储和操作数据。
希望本文对您理解Java常量和变量有所帮助!
参考链接
- [Java教程 - 常量](
- [Java教程 - 变量](